Gates and Inverters onsemi MC74VHC00DT Overview

The onsemi MC74VHC00DT is a quintessential component designed for various high-speed logic applications requiring NAND gate functionality. It's a sophisticated embodiment of onsemi's dedication to integrating efficiency with high performance. This integrated circuit is composed of four independent NAND gates with two inputs each, packed neatly into a 14-TSSOP. Its design is aimed at facilitating better signal distribution while minimizing power consumption, thereby delivering an optimal solution for designers looking for reliable logic-level shifting and high-drive capabilities. MC74VHC00DT Features

- Advanced High-Speed CMOS Technology
- Four Independent NAND Gates
- Two Inputs per Gate
- Optimal 14-TSSOP Packaging for Space-Efficient Designs
- Lower Power Consumption
- Compatible with TTL Levels
- High Noise Immunity
